San Francisco Giants: Catcher
No room for Buster: The Giants looked long and hard for a place for Buster Posey, but San Francisco's catcher of the future apparently will remain just that and Eli Whiteside will begin the season as the backup catcher.
Ray Ratto of the San Francisco Chronicle reports that Posey is all but certain to begin the season at Triple-A Fresno.
A number of off days early in the season will allow Bengie Molina to be behind the plate on a regular basis in April. Unless Molina gets hurt, Ratto predicts that Posey will likely not be back with the big club until June 1, when the Giants can push his arbitration clock back another year.
The Giants tried Posey at first base this spring, but are uncomfortable using him as a late-inning replacement for Aubrey Huff.
